Why is my printer only printing half a page

There are several reasons why your printer may only print half a page. Here are some possible explanations:

#1. The printer is out of ink or toner

If your printer is low on ink or toner, it may not be able to print the entire page. Check the ink or toner levels and replace them if necessary.

#2. The printer is experiencing a hardware issue

There may be a problem with the printer’s hardware causing it only to print half a page. It could be an issue with the printhead, the rollers, or another mechanical component. In this case, it may be necessary to seek the help of a professional or contact the manufacturer for assistance.

#3. There is an issue with the document being printed

Sometimes, the issue may not be with the printer itself but rather with the document that is being printed. For example, the document may be too large for the printer’s paper tray, or there may be formatting issues causing the printer to stop mid-page. In this case, it may be necessary to adjust the settings of your document or try printing it on a different printer.

#4. There is a problem with the printer driver

The printer driver is the software that tells your computer how to communicate with the printer. If there is a problem with the printer driver, it can cause your printer to malfunction. Make sure that you have the latest version of the printer driver installed and that it is properly configured.

How do I update or install the printer driver on my computer?

To update or install the printer driver on your computer, you must visit the manufacturer’s website and download the latest version of the driver. Select the driver specifically designed for your make and model printer. Once you have downloaded the driver, follow the prompts to install it on your computer.
